I see Deals like this and wonder why people buy Netbooks at all... Dell D420 for $289

(Click the Pic for Link to Buy.com)

Dell D420 is a 12.1" Screen Ultra Light notebook at 3.8 lbs. With a Core Duo 1.2 ghz CPU and 1.5 GB of Ram. Refurbished at $289, why would you buy a $300 netbook?  This deal will give you a Bigger Screen, More RAM and certainly a more robust CPU.

 

Not that I'm crazy about Dell notebooks, but it just seems odd to me to buy a Netbook, unless you need something to be so light and small that it fits into a purse or coat pocket. But at that size I really question functionality.
